TOBII_RESEARCH_API TobiiResearchStatus TOBII_RESEARCH_CALL tobii_research_set_gaze_output_frequency(TobiiResearchEyeTracker *eyetracker, float gaze_output_frequency)
Sets the gaze output frequency of the eye tracker.
TOBII_RESEARCH_API void TOBII_RESEARCH_CALL tobii_research_free_gaze_output_frequencies(TobiiResearchGazeOutputFrequencies *frequencies)
Free memory allocation for the gaze output frequencies received via tobii_research_free_gaze_output_f...
TOBII_RESEARCH_API TobiiResearchStatus TOBII_RESEARCH_CALL tobii_research_get_all_gaze_output_frequencies(TobiiResearchEyeTracker *eyetracker, TobiiResearchGazeOutputFrequencies **frequencies)
Gets an array of gaze output frequencies supported by the eye tracker.
TOBII_RESEARCH_API TobiiResearchStatus TOBII_RESEARCH_CALL tobii_research_get_gaze_output_frequency(TobiiResearchEyeTracker *eyetracker, float *gaze_output_frequency)
Gets the gaze output frequency of the eye tracker.
